Screaming woman publicly flogged by laughing policemen in shocking video from Sudan


www.dailymail.co.u k

Sudan's judiciary opened an investigation into the horrifying video of a woman being flogged that has been widely circulated on the internet, the state news agency reported Sunday The video shows a woman in a voluminous cloak on her knees screaming and pleading with blue- uniformed policemen, identified as Sudanese, who take turns whipping her across the head and feet. One officer laughs when he realizes he is being filmed
